24小时热门版块排行榜    

Znn3bq.jpeg
查看: 1805  |  回复: 6

Ace_xt

铜虫 (初入文坛)

[求助] 表面摩擦做平衡的若干问题 已有1人参与

本人最近在用LAMMPS做摩擦,模型为z方向上下两个表面,x、y、z方向都赋予周期性边界条件,中间加水。我想在上下表面分别沿x轴正负方向运动的同时能在z方向做npt,使盒子在z方向有一定的伸缩以保证中间用于摩擦的水的压强不变。但是在做平衡时,赋予所有原子初速度并在z方向npt,为上下表面赋予定时位移后模型没能正常运动。请问可能是什么原因?另外脚本有无其它问题?下面是我做平衡的脚本,新手上路,请大家多多批评指正!
##########################
#  Initialization
#-------------------------
boundary        p p p
units           real

#------------------------------
# Force field specifications
#------------------------------
atom_style      full
bond_style      harmonic
angle_style     charmm
dihedral_style  charmm
pair_style      lj/charmm/coul/charmm 10 12
pair_modify     mix arithmetic
neigh_modify    every 2 delay 10 check yes
special_bonds   charmm

#----------------
# Read geometry
#----------------
read_data       solved_d10.data

#---------------------
# Define Groups
#---------------------
group           water     type 1 10
group           wato      type 10
group           allsulfur type 7
group           uppersurf molecule <> 49 96
group           lowersurf molecule <> 1  48
group           uppersulfur    intersect allsulfur uppersurf
group           lowersulfur    intersect allsulfur lowersurf
group           uppernosulfur  subtract  uppersurf uppersulfur
group           lowernosulfur  subtract  lowersurf lowersulfur
group           pControl       union     lowernosulfur uppernosulfur water
group           twosurfs       union     lowersurf uppersurf

#---------------------
# Fix all sulfur atoms
#---------------------
fix                 fixsulfur allsulfur setforce 0.0 0.0 0.0

#--------------
# Minimization
#--------------
min_style       sd
minimize        0.0 1.0e-8 1000 100000

#-----------------------
# Initialize velocities
#-----------------------
velocity         all create 10.0 4928459 rot yes mom yes dist gaussian

#---------------------
# Shake all H atoms
#---------------------
fix                 shakeH all shake 0.0001 20 0 m 1.0 a 11

#---------------------
## Set Shear Velocity
##---------------------
variable        xu equal vdisplace(0.0,0.0001)
variable        xl equal vdisplace(0.0,-0.0001)
fix                vu uppersurf move variable v_xu NULL NULL NULL NULL NULL
fix                vl lowersurf move variable v_xl NULL NULL NULL NULL NULL

#--------------------------------
# Define the integration method
#--------------------------------
fix                1  all npt temp 10.0 300.0 100.0 z 1.0 1.0 1000.0

#-------------------------------
# Customize output infomration
#-------------------------------
thermo          10000  
thermo_style    multi
dump                mydump  all atom 10000 trjequil.lammpstrj   
restart         500000  res.equil                           

附件中是模型视图
表面摩擦做平衡的若干问题
回复此楼

» 猜你喜欢

» 本主题相关价值贴推荐,对您同样有帮助:

已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

Ace_xt

铜虫 (初入文坛)

自顶一下,确实毫无头绪,是不是不能在运动的同时进行升温操作
2楼2015-05-21 10:58:45
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

lx_PICO

铁虫 (正式写手)

【答案】应助回帖

感谢参与,应助指数 +1
1.你的0.0001初始值相对于velocity       all create 10.0是很小的,没有意义
2.都是周期条件不能用这样的加载吧,用fix deform试试

» 本帖已获得的红花(最新10朵)

3楼2015-05-21 15:23:24
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

Ace_xt

铜虫 (初入文坛)

送红花一朵
引用回帖:
3楼: Originally posted by lx_PICO at 2015-05-21 15:23:24
1.你的0.0001初始值相对于velocity       all create 10.0是很小的,没有意义
2.都是周期条件不能用这样的加载吧,用fix deform试试

谢谢回复!你的意思是说可能赋的初速度抵消了设置的速度吗?但是fix move那一步我只给了位置的变化,没有给它速度啊。另外,因为我想要在z向恒压,fix deform可以做到吗?
4楼2015-05-21 17:49:19
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

lx_PICO

铁虫 (正式写手)

【答案】应助回帖

引用回帖:
4楼: Originally posted by Ace_xt at 2015-05-21 17:49:19
谢谢回复!你的意思是说可能赋的初速度抵消了设置的速度吗?但是fix move那一步我只给了位置的变化,没有给它速度啊。另外,因为我想要在z向恒压,fix deform可以做到吗?...

哦,你是位移加载,我看成了速度。
你的恒压是在fix npt 下设置的吧,和fix deform冲突吗?总之非周期这样加剪切是不对的
5楼2015-05-21 20:18:41
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

Ace_xt

铜虫 (初入文坛)

引用回帖:
5楼: Originally posted by lx_PICO at 2015-05-21 20:18:41
哦,你是位移加载,我看成了速度。
你的恒压是在fix npt 下设置的吧,和fix deform冲突吗?总之非周期这样加剪切是不对的...

如果不能在z向恒压,那单纯做z向的伸缩没有意义啊,或者有其他什么可以在z向恒压的办法吗?我将z向设周期性边界条件也是无奈,非周期性边界条件方向NPT不能做,为了上下表面不形成镜像相互作用,还特地在两端留下一部分以超出截断距离。
6楼2015-05-21 21:53:07
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

哦紧迫看

新虫 (初入文坛)

引用回帖:
6楼: Originally posted by Ace_xt at 2015-05-21 21:53:07
如果不能在z向恒压,那单纯做z向的伸缩没有意义啊,或者有其他什么可以在z向恒压的办法吗?我将z向设周期性边界条件也是无奈,非周期性边界条件方向NPT不能做,为了上下表面不形成镜像相互作用,还特地在两端留下一 ...

兄弟  z方向可以不用设置为周期性边界的
7楼2017-03-13 13:12:55
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
相关版块跳转 我要订阅楼主 Ace_xt 的主题更新
最具人气热帖推荐 [查看全部] 作者 回/看 最后发表
[考博] 光量子物理方向 博士招生 1人(2026.09) +3 sandyworld 2026-05-15 3/150 2026-05-16 17:11 by zznnnj
[有机交流] 求有机合成大神指点三硫酸乙烯酯(CAS:2793408-99-6)的合成路线 30+3 Leekmid 2026-05-13 10/500 2026-05-16 16:37 by czyzsu
[公派出国] 售SCI一区T0P文章,我:8.O.5.5.1.O.5.4,科目齐全,可+急 +5 l7k6xnh0yc 2026-05-14 5/250 2026-05-16 16:35 by x28q7dxf75
[有机交流] 如何实现卤原子转化 10+3 BT20230424 2026-05-15 5/250 2026-05-16 16:20 by czyzsu
[硕博家园] 售SCI一区T0P文章,我:8.O.5.5.1.O.5.4,科目齐全,可+急 +3 x0mp7owy2b 2026-05-15 3/150 2026-05-16 12:49 by vcdazktkjx
[硕博家园] 考博自荐 +3 科研狗111 2026-05-13 4/200 2026-05-16 11:45 by 科研狗111
[考博] 售SCI一区T0P文章,我:8.O.5.5.1.O.5.4,科目齐全,可+急 +4 l7k6xnh0yc 2026-05-14 4/200 2026-05-16 11:36 by h3oerqvkv9
[硕博家园] 售SCI一区T0P文章,我:8.O.5.5.1.O.5.4,科目齐全,可+急 +4 cjf4bx70cj 2026-05-14 6/300 2026-05-16 11:16 by h3oerqvkv9
[硕博家园] 申请博士 +3 呃?呃 2026-05-15 3/150 2026-05-16 11:01 by a4742549
[基金申请] 这年头没有找到涵评专家,还有中面上的可能吗 +11 dd921ww 2026-05-12 13/650 2026-05-16 09:16 by Howard28
[文学芳草园] 窗边初夏的小雨 +8 阿美_Lml888 2026-05-09 11/550 2026-05-15 23:54 by WASM
[考博] 西南大学考核制博士 +4 lijunjie84 2026-05-11 7/350 2026-05-15 23:20 by 同仁堂教主
[论文投稿] 有带发论文的吗 +4 山楂之术 2026-05-09 4/200 2026-05-15 15:40 by 妹子不好惹
[基金申请] 青C资助名额大幅增加! +11 西葫芦炒鸡蛋 2026-05-13 15/750 2026-05-15 14:36 by ambravo
[基金申请] 精华III评审感受-评审感受-评审感受 +14 ferrarichen 2026-05-11 18/900 2026-05-15 11:12 by cmhchen
[教师之家] 教学课件你会给同学吗 +8 硕士研究生吗 2026-05-13 8/400 2026-05-14 22:23 by 常规沥青
[有机交流] 求助2,4-二氯-5-嘧啶甲醛的合成方法 20+3 光吃不拉 2026-05-14 5/250 2026-05-14 20:15 by 一切都是空工
[高分子] 本人最近太闲了,谁有问题可以提,每天会统一回复 +8 一切都是空工 2026-05-12 19/950 2026-05-14 20:03 by 一切都是空工
[论文投稿] 求助大佬sci投稿哪个好中 +3 江沅188 2026-05-12 4/200 2026-05-13 14:35 by 江沅188
[考博] 现在不知道怎么办,感觉很痛苦 +4 qweww 2026-05-11 5/250 2026-05-11 20:23 by Oversize
信息提示
请填处理意见